In addition, we present a novel method to measure the diameter of straight and seamless plastic pipes. A pair of line-structured lasers, which locate on different sides of the pipe but in a common plane, cast on the pipe to create two elliptical arcs. The CCD camera captures these two arcs. Major and minor axis radii and spatial 3D coordinates of every corresponding elliptical cross-section center can be calculated through ellipse fitting. A pair of line-structured laser sensors, each of which includes a line-structured laser and a CCD camera, are placed at every sampling cross section of the pipe, and thus the pipe’s cross-section diameter and furthermore the straightness of the pipe can be solved. We provide an on-line machine vision method for measuring a seamless steel pipe’s diameter and straightness, including the design of the system, the deduction of the mathematical model, and the research of the experimental results},
